Morogoro is a lively city located in Tanzania, East Africa. It sits at the base of the Uluguru Mountains and alongside the Great Ruaha River, Making it an ideal location for nature lovers. As one of Tanzania’s oldest towns, Morogoro has a rich cultural heritage that can be seen in its architecture, Food, Music and art. The locals are welcoming to visitors from all over the globe and speak Swahili as their primary language with English also widely spoken.

The natural beauty of Morogoro is one of its main attractions with hiking trails leading to breathtaking waterfalls or safari tours to see wildlife such as elephants, Lions or giraffes at Mikumi National Park which lies just 120km away. The bustling market scene offers fresh produce like fruits and vegetables grown on nearby farms as well as handmade crafts made from local materials like sisal or banana fibers. Primary Industries

  • Morogoro is a significant agricultural center in Tanzania, emphasizing crop production and livestock farming.
  • The city also houses multiple manufacturing industries, comprising food processing, textiles, and construction materials.
  • Notable businesses in Morogoro involve transportation and logistics firms, retail stores, banks, and telecommunications providers.
  • Additionally, the city’s proximity to renowned national parks like Mikumi National Park has resulted in a burgeoning tourism industry.

    Cuisine

    1. Nyama Choma – grilled meat, often served with ugali (a cornmeal porridge) and vegetables. This dish is available at many restaurants in Morogoro.
    2. Pilau – a spiced rice dish that is popular throughout Tanzania. Many local restaurants serve pilau as either a main course or side dish.
    3. Chipsi Mayai – a favorite street food made from french fries and eggs mixed together and fried until crispy.
    4. Ndizi Nyama – a traditional Tanzanian meal made with plantains (ndizi) cooked with meat (nyama).
